Do You Stick to Your Holiday Budget?



      Well the Holiday Season is upon us again.  Many of use are decorating our homes, planning that big Xmas dinner and of course shopping for gifts.  Our stress levels begin to rise with every phase of the Holiday planning and the expense of it all!


      How much money should you plan to set aside for this holiday season?  Money experts suggest spending no more than 1.5% of your annual income on holiday spending.  To give you a visual, if your annual income is $50,000 at 1.5% =$750.00 to spend.

     Now the question is what items should be included in the budget. Every year I compose a list to aid in this process and to make sure I have covered all basis.

How much do you plan to spend in the following categories:

  • Special events
  • Holiday outfits
  • Gifts
  • Family
  • Hostess
  • Shipping costs
  • Food
  • At home entertaining
  • Baking
  • Travel

After compiling my list, I simply do a spread sheet in Excel to ensure I stay with in my budget.
